ATTACK #4 ? The Bible has errors regarding the genealogy of Jesus.
A. The problem with the genealogies. Matthew traces the geneology of Christ down through Solomon, and Luke traces it down through Nathan. The real rub is seen when Joseph?s father in Matthew is Jacob (Mt. 1:16), but in Luke his father is Eli (Lk. 3:23).
B. Some solutions:
1) Matthew gives us the genealogy of Joseph and Luke gives us the genealogy of Mary.
2) Both trace the lineage of Joseph but Matthew recorded the physical or royal descent of Joseph from Solomon, while Luke gives us his legal lineage through Nathan.
